.custom-form-wrap,.popup .content{position:relative}.btl-form-loading-overlay{position:absolute;inset:0;display:none;align-items:center;justify-content:center;background:rgba(255,255,255,.74);backdrop-filter:blur(2px);z-index:50;border-radius:inherit}.btl-form-is-loading .btl-form-loading-overlay{display:flex}.btl-form-loading-box{display:inline-flex;align-items:center;gap:12px;padding:14px 18px;background:#fff;border-radius:14px;box-shadow:0 10px 32px rgba(0,0,0,.14);font-size:15px;line-height:1.35;color:#00568d;text-align:center}.btl-form-spinner{width:22px;height:22px;border:3px solid rgba(0,155,217,.25);border-top-color:#009bd9;border-radius:50%;animation:btlFormSpin .75s linear infinite;flex:0 0 auto}.btl-form-loading-text{font-weight:500;color:#00568d}form[id^=btl-custom-form-] button[type=submit].is-loading{opacity:.75;pointer-events:none}.btl-form-loading-error{margin-top:12px;padding:10px 12px;border-radius:10px;background:#fff3f3;color:#9b1c1c;font-size:14px;line-height:1.35}@keyframes btlFormSpin{to{transform:rotate(360deg)}}@media (max-width:767px){.btl-form-loading-overlay{position:fixed;inset:0;display:none;align-items:center;justify-content:center;z-index:99999;padding:20px;background:rgba(255,255,255,.72);backdrop-filter:blur(2px);border-radius:0}.btl-form-is-loading .btl-form-loading-overlay{display:flex}.btl-form-loading-box{position:fixed;left:50%;top:50%;z-index:100000;transform:translate(-50%,-50%);width:calc(100vw - 32px);max-width:360px;min-width:280px;padding:18px 20px;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:12px;text-align:center;font-size:14px}.btl-form-spinner{margin:0 auto}.btl-form-loading-text{display:block;width:100%;text-align:center;color:#00568d;font-weight:500;line-height:1.35}body.btl-form-submit-loading{overflow:hidden}}